Yemeni honey enjoys a strong reputation both regionally and globally, thanks to its high quality and natural components that have largely remained untouched by human intervention.

In this context, Abdulaziz Al-Junaid, Director General of Animal Wealth at the Ministry of Agriculture in Sana'a, stated that there are significant investment opportunities in the field of beekeeping and honey production in Yemen, particularly given the diversity and global reputation of Yemeni honey.

He added that recent government measures to protect the reputation and status of Yemeni honey—specifically by banning large-scale imports of foreign honey—have greatly contributed to safeguarding local production and opening new avenues for investment in beekeeping and honey production.

In a statement to Al-Istithmar magazine, Al-Junaid explained that beekeeping and honey production were once merely hobbies for some farmers but are now gradually becoming a growing profession. He noted that building a global brand for Yemeni honey requires organized efforts and increased investment in this sector.

Al-Junaid affirmed that there is an official direction aimed at developing and promoting beekeeping and honey production to generate revenue that supports the national economy with foreign currency. This signifies major investment opportunities, with investors able to capitalize on Yemeni honey's excellent reputation to market products internationally.

According to data from the Ministry of Agriculture in Sana'a, the number of beekeepers in Yemen is estimated at around 100,000. Yemeni honey production has seen a significant increase over the past decade, with recent statistics estimating Yemen's 2024 honey output at approximately 7,000 tons of various types, notably including Sidr, Samar, Dhoba, and Shu'fi honeys.
